Registered Nurse - Interventional Radiology Job Summary
The RN functions as a member of the interdisciplinary team caring for patients who are undergoing procedures or exams in the Department of Radiology and Biomedical Imaging. The RN carries out established nursing procedures to prepare patients prior to Radiologic procedures, during the procedure or exam, and following the procedure during recovery. The RN assists with the management of patient care during moderate sedation and support anesthesia cases.
The RN assists in the care of patients of all ages, including pediatrics. The RN will be providing staffing coverage where they are needed the most. The RN will be flexible to work at all UCSF Medical Center sites and demonstrate flexibility in variable work hours.

Required Qualifications- Three - five years of recent RN experience in Interventional Radiology and Neuro-Interventional Radiology
- Ability to wear lead apron required in Interventional Radiology and Neuro Interventional Radiology
- Moderate Sedation competency required in Interventional Radiology and Neuro Interventional Radiology
- The flexibility to orient and work at all UCSF Health locations
- Certification in Radiology Imaging Nursing
- Three to five years of RN experience in pediatric Interventional Radiology
- Recent critical care experience
- Active Registered Nurse licensure in the State of California
- Active American Heart Association CPR Certification
- Active American Heart Association ACLS Certification
